Regular season is over so we can put together our all conference teams now. Official ballots were due on Sunday I think. I put my unofficial team together after the Wisconsin/Minnesota blood bath today.

First Team All-WCHA

F-Blake Geoffrion (Wisconsin)-Senior
F-Rhett Rakhshani (Denver)-Senior
F-Justin Fontaine (Minnesota-Duluth)-Junior
D-Brendan Smith (Wisconsin)-Junior
D-Patrick Wiercoich (Denver)-Sophomore
G-Marc Cheverie (Denver)-Junior

Second Team All-WCHA

F-Michael Davies (Wisconsin)-Senior
F-Jack Connolly (Minnesota-Duluth)-Sophomore
F-Ryan Lasch (St. Cloud State)-Senior
D-Ryan McDonagh (Wisconsin)-Junior
D-Nate Prosser (Colorado College)-Senior
G-Brad Eidsness (North Dakota)-Sophomore

Third Team All-WCHA

F-Mike Connolly (Minnesota-Duluth)-Sophomore
F-Kevin Clark (Alaska Anchorage)-Senior
F-Garrett Roe (St. Cloud State)-Junior
D-Kurt Davis (Minnesota State)-Junior
D-Garrett Raboin (St. Cloud State)-Senior
G-Alex Kangas (Minnesota)-Junior

WCHA All-Freshman Team

F-Craig Smith (Wisconsin)
F-Danny Kristo (North Dakota)
F-Rylan Schwartz (Colorado College)
D-Matt Donovan (Denver)
D-Nick Leddy (Minnesota)
G-Mike Lee (St. Cloud State)

Awards

WCHA Player of the Year: Marc Cheverie, Goalie (Denver)
WCHA Rookie of the Year: Craig Smith, Forward (Wisconsin)
WCHA Defenseman of the Year: Brendan Smith, Defense (Wisconsin)
